**Join Our Team as a Casual Youth Care Worker**
Ranch Ehrlo is seeking for highly motivated individuals to fulfill the rewarding role of Youth Care Worker (YCW) within our agency.
**Position Overview**:
Are you passionate about making a difference in the lives of children, youth, and adults with complex needs? Join our team as a Youth Care Worker and become a part of a dynamic, inclusive environment where you can provide care, support, and guidance to those who need it most. As a Youth Care Worker, you will be a key player in creating a safe, nurturing, and structured living environment. You will work alongside participants to help them grow, thrive, and reach their full potential. Your role will involve fully engaging in all aspects of the group living experience, offering both emotional and physical support while being a positive role model.
**Shift Working Ho**urs**:There are a variety of shift start and end times, but these are the most common**:
**Weekdays 15:00-00:00, 23:30-09:30.**
**Weekends and non-school days 08:00-20:00, 09:00-21:00, 10:00-22:00, 11:00-23:00, 12:00-00:00, 23:30-11:30**
**Benefits of the role include**:
- shifts hours which provide many individuals the flexibility to attend classes, coordinate childcare and allow plenty of time for outside interests
- A fast-paced environment where you are active with youth out in the community doing activities such as swimming, hiking, fishing, and attending community events.
- The opportunity to build genuine relationships with youth who have experienced complex challenges including behavioral issues, mental health disorders, substance dependency and other related issues
- Excellent work experience for those looking to work in the fields of education, social work, nursing, corrections, or policing
**Qualifications**:
Education and Professional Certification
- Completion of a High school diploma.
- A certificate, diploma, or degree in Child and Youth Care (CYC) or a related field is an asset.
**Experience**
- At least one (1) year of experience working with children, youth, and/or adults with behavioral, cognitive, mental health, or developmental challenges.
**Skills and Characteristics**:
- Team player with a collaborative attitude, ready to work alongside others in a supportive environment.
- Strong interpersonal skills that allow you to build genuine connections with participants and colleagues.
- Leadership that motivates, guides, and models positive behaviors for those you support.
- Engaging and creative—whether it's through outdoor adventures, arts, sports, or other activities, you’ll find ways to connect with participants.
- Emotional intelligence that helps you remain patient, empathetic, and understanding in every situation.
- Problem-solving skills to navigate challenges and make thoughtful decisions.
- Knowledge of behavior management and support strategies that can help resolve conflicts and handle crises.
- A flexible mindset that allows you to adapt to new situations and challenges.
- Open to learning—continuously seeking out opportunities for growth and development.
- Basic computer skills and the ability to leverage them in your daily tasks.
**Duties and Responsibilities**:
**Services**
- Provide compassionate support to individuals with complex needs, fostering a safe and nurturing environment where they feel valued and supported.
- Bring your creativity to life by helping develop and implement engaging activity plans that encourage participation.
- Collaborate with clinical professionals and unit managers to share insights that will help guide treatment plans and goal setting.
- Actively participate in team meetings, contributing your ideas and experiences to help improve the care we provide.
- Teach essential life skills like self-care, cooking, cleaning, budgeting, and building positive social connections.
- Resolve conflicts with empathy and use behavior management strategies such as conflict resolution, crisis management, and life space interviewing to guide participants through challenges.
- Complete documentation and reports with accuracy and clarity, ensuring all agency standards are met.
- Perform other related duties as needed to support participants and the team.
**Leadership**:
- Guide and support new employees, practicum students, and volunteers, as directed by the unit manager.
- Lead by example, representing the agency’s values and demonstrating fairness, respect, and positivity.
- Collaborate and communicate with the multidisciplinary team when required.
**Management of Resources**:
- Contribute to the operational budget and unit’s capital plan.
- Track and reconcile expenses, submitting receipts for approved expenditures.
- Ensure agency vehicle logs are completed accurately when needed.
